Sexual Reproduction
The process by which organisms produce offspring through the combination of genetic materials from two different cells, typically involving male and female gametes.
Genetic Diversity
The total number of genetic characteristics in the genetic makeup of a species, contributing to its ability to adapt and survive changes.
Asexual Reproduction
A mode of reproduction that does not involve the fusion of gametes, resulting in offspring genetically identical to the parent.
Diploid Cells
Cells that have two complete sets of chromosomes, one from each parent, characteristic of most organisms’ body cells.
